As a Composite Operator, you will serve as a vital link in the production of structures that make modern aviation possible. Working within a high-performing, self-directed team, you will be responsible for the fabrication and assembly of composite parts for both standard production and cutting-edge developmental aircraft programs. Your daily operations will involve the precise use of hand, power, and machine tools for layout and assembly. To ensure the highest levels of safety and accuracy, you will strictly adhere to detailed blueprints and work instructions while utilizing precision measurement devices???such as calipers, micrometers, and scales???to perform rigorous quality inspections on every part produced. ...Working hours:

To be successful in this role, you must possess an extraordinary level of attention to detail and the ability to identify minute deviations to ensure perfection in every component. Candidates must be proficient in basic shop mathematics, demonstrating the ability to perform the calculations necessary for complex measurements and layouts. Furthermore, strong verbal communication skills are essential, as you will be required to coordinate effectively with your teammates to meet demanding production, cost, and schedule goals in a fast-paced environment.
